Geistlich Sons
Geistlich is a global leader in regenerative medicine, developing, manufacturing, and distributing advanced medical devices for bone, cartilage, and tissue regeneration. With a history dating back over 170 years, Geistlich is committed to scientific excellence, Swiss quality, and improving patients' quality of life through innovative solutions and research-driven approaches. The company emphasizes scientific research, clinical efficacy, and high-quality standards, with a strong focus on regenerative solutions for dental, orthopedic, and other medical fields. The company also actively engages in social responsibility initiatives, supporting projects worldwide such as coral reef and children's dental projects, and promotes young talent through apprenticeships.

Products
Bone substitute materials (bone graft matrix)
Implantable bone substitute matrices derived from natural bone for use in dental and orthopedic bone regeneration procedures.
Resorbable collagen membranes
Resorbable collagen membranes used to support guided tissue and bone regeneration procedures.
Collagen-derived soft-tissue matrices
Matrix products intended to support soft-tissue augmentation and keratinized tissue gain in oral procedures.
Additively manufactured titanium scaffold
Three-dimensional titanium scaffolds produced by additive manufacturing for clinical bone defect reconstruction and guided bone regeneration.
Collagen-based wound-care matrix
Matrix product designed to support advanced wound healing in clinical wound-care applications.
Infection-control medicinal and device products
Products and formulations intended for infection-control use in clinical settings.

Services
Clinical education and training
Courses, congresses, webinars and hands-on workshops (in-person and virtual) for dental and orthopedic professionals; includes distribution of training kits for remote practical training and multilingual congress support.
Research partnerships, foundation grants and consortium coordination
Support and funding of independent research through partnerships and foundations, and coordination of participation in international, grant-funded research consortia to advance regenerative therapies.
Global distribution and sales partnership
Distribution of regenerative medical devices and materials through an international affiliate and distributor network to provide regional market access and logistics support.
Prototype development, material testing and preclinical evaluation
In-house development and iterative testing of prototypes, material formulation, and preclinical evaluation to progress products from concept toward clinical testing and manufacturing readiness.
